Top notch documentation or ‘record keeping’ is crucial to the provision of safe and effective healthcare – it is not an optional extra. This course on Documentation in Healthcare addresses the legislation and guidelines underpinning documentation. It takes the learner through the importance of accurate documentation and explores the consequences of poor quality record keeping.
